# Close-ExcelPackage
|
||||
|
||||
## SYNOPSIS
|
||||
Closes an Excel Package, saving, saving under a new name or abandoning changes and opening the file in Excel as required.
|
||||
|
||||
## SYNTAX
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
Close-ExcelPackage [-ExcelPackage] <ExcelPackage> [-Show] [-NoSave] [[-SaveAs] <Object>] [[-Password] <String>] [-Calculate] [<CommonParameters>]
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
## DESCRIPTION
|
||||
When working with an ExcelPackage object, the Workbook is held in memory and not saved until the .Save() method of the package is called.
|
||||
|
||||
Close-ExcelPackage saves and disposes of the Package object.
|
||||
|
||||
It can be called with -NoSave to abandon the file without saving, with a new "SaveAs" filename, and/or with a password to protect the file. And -Show will open the file in Excel; -Calculate will try to update the workbook, although not everything can be recalculated

## EXAMPLES
|
||||
|
||||
### EXAMPLE 1
|
||||
```
|
||||
Close-ExcelPackage -show $excel
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
$excel holds a package object, this saves the workbook and loads it into Excel.
|
||||
|
||||
### EXAMPLE 2
|
||||
```
|
||||
Close-ExcelPackage -NoSave $excel
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
$excel holds a package object, this disposes of it without writing it to disk.
